• Researchers introduce amplitude-modulated kilohertz magnetic perturbation (AM-kTMP), a new non-invasive brain stimulation (NIBS) method for manipulating speech perception.1
  • Speech perception is hypothesized to exploit neural activity that entrains to the rhythmic properties of spoken utterances.1
  • Perceptual sensitivity varies with the phase of oscillatory activity induced by speech itself.1
  • Earlier work found that perceptual sensitivity also varies with an external oscillatory perturbation from transcranial alternating current stimulation (tACS) over the temporal lobe.1
  • This study applies kilohertz transcranial magnetic perturbation (kTMP), in which a low-frequency perturbation is delivered via magnetic stimulation, as an alternative to tACS-style entrainment.1
  • The findings are reported as a bioRxiv Neuroscience preprint on using oscillatory magnetic perturbation to steer speech perception.1 1
